Output 593589f939001099c26f60af54fcc70ad1c1903d616e63b7408007bfa19136b6:1

value
261380
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dd1b0166e81b3e724b89d029cbc62e86a230597 OP_EQUALVERIFY OP_CHECKSIG
address
186UE8z2d8F8iw7LVEixsBCfRDnTf3d8Mc
transaction
593589f939001099c26f60af54fcc70ad1c1903d616e63b7408007bfa19136b6